  1. Google Search Console average position dropping back down

A few months ago we shared that the average position sharply increased for many sites when Google made that number 100 change blocking a lot of automated queries. Now it’s being reported that for many sites the number is dropping again, signaling that there may be a workaround for blocking the bots and automated queries. Earlier in December many sites were seeing a drop in their average position while impressions skyrocketed again, and marketer Glenn Gabe speculates some scrapers are now getting through.   1. Google: Optimization for AI Search is the same as for traditional search

In a recent interview Nick Fox, SVP of Knowledge and Information at Google, stated that optimization for AI search is the same as what you do for web search and traditional SEO. While there has always been a lot of evidence to support this claim, hearing it from a key player at Google solidifies the strategies that many marketers already had in place.   1. The future of travel is Gen-Z: Smart tech, self-care, and social discovery

Skyscanner, a leading global travel booking site, recently released their 2026 travel trends report, highlighting cultural forces and emerging behaviors defining how Gen-Z will travel in the coming year. Key takeaways included that a large majority of the general are planning more trips abroad in 2026 than previous years, 40% of Gen-Z seek beauty treatments and stores while traveling (#BeautyTok), more young people are using travel to meet people, and the use of AI to plan and book trips continues to rise.
